[clang-doc] Attaching a name to reference data
This adds the name of the referenced decl, in addition to its USR, to the saved data, so that the backend can look at an info in isolation and still be able to construct a human-readable name for it. Differential Revision: https://reviews.llvm.org/D46281 llvm-svn: 331539
